Benefits of Logistics Software
1. Increased Efficiency and Time Savings
One of the biggest advantages of logistics software is its ability to automate time-consuming tasks, such as shipment tracking, order processing, and inventory management. Automation eliminates human errors, reduces manual workload, and allows businesses to handle higher volumes of shipments with ease.
2. Cost Reduction and Optimized Resource Utilization
By automating logistics processes, businesses can significantly reduce costs associated with manual labor, fuel consumption, and inventory mismanagement. Advanced algorithms help optimize delivery routes, reducing fuel expenses and improving fleet efficiency.
3. Real-Time Tracking and Visibility
Logistics software integrates real-time tracking features that provide businesses and customers with visibility into the shipping process. GPS-enabled tracking allows businesses to monitor fleet movements, predict delivery times, and enhance customer satisfaction by providing accurate updates.
4. Improved Accuracy and Error Reduction
Manual data entry often leads to errors in order fulfillment, shipment labeling, and billing. Logistics software eliminates these risks by automating data processing, ensuring that orders are fulfilled correctly and invoices are accurate.
5. Enhanced Customer Experience
With automated logistics software, businesses can offer faster delivery times, transparent tracking information, and better communication with customers. Features like automated notifications, estimated delivery times, and seamless returns management contribute to a positive customer experience.
6. Scalability for Growing Businesses
As businesses expand, their logistics needs become more complex. Logistics software solutions are scalable, allowing businesses to add new features, integrate with multiple carriers, and handle larger shipment volumes without major disruptions.
7. Compliance with Industry Regulations
The logistics industry is subject to various regulations, including safety standards, taxation policies, and customs requirements. Logistics software ensures compliance by automating documentation processes and maintaining up-to-date regulatory data.
Future Trends in Logistics Software Development
1. Artificial Intelligence and Machine Learning
AI and machine learning are shaping the future of logistics by enabling predictive analytics, route optimization, and demand forecasting. AI-powered software can analyze vast amounts of data to suggest the most efficient shipping strategies and improve decision-making.
2. Blockchain Technology for Transparency and Security
Blockchain is revolutionizing supply chain management by offering secure and transparent record-keeping. It enhances trust between parties, reduces fraud, and ensures accurate tracking of shipments.
3. Integration of Internet of Things (IoT)
IoT technology allows real-time tracking of shipments using smart sensors. Businesses can monitor temperature-sensitive goods, prevent theft, and optimize warehouse management using IoT-connected devices.
4. Automation in Last-Mile Delivery
The last-mile delivery segment is undergoing automation with the use of drones, autonomous vehicles, and robotic delivery solutions. Logistics software will integrate with these technologies to offer faster and more efficient deliveries.
5. Green and Sustainable Logistics Solutions
With increasing environmental concerns, logistics software is incorporating features that help businesses adopt sustainable practices. Optimized route planning, fuel-efficient transportation, and eco-friendly packaging solutions are becoming key components of modern logistics software.
Cost to Hire a Logistics Software Developer
1. Factors Affecting Development Costs
The cost of developing logistics software depends on several factors, including:
- Feature Complexity: Basic software with standard features costs less, while AI-driven solutions with predictive analytics are more expensive.
- Integration Requirements: Connecting logistics software with e-commerce platforms, ERP systems, and third-party APIs increases development costs.
- Customization Needs: Tailor-made solutions designed to fit specific business needs cost more than off-the-shelf software.
- Developer Experience and Location: Hiring developers from regions like North America and Western Europe is costlier compared to hiring from Asia or Eastern Europe.
2. Estimated Development Costs
- Basic Logistics Software: $10,000 – $30,000 (Includes core features like order tracking, inventory management, and basic automation.)
- Mid-Level Software: $30,000 – $70,000 (Includes real-time tracking, API integrations, and data analytics.)
- Enterprise-Level Software: $70,000 – $150,000+ (Includes AI-driven features, blockchain security, and IoT connectivity.)
3. Hiring Options
- Freelancers: Suitable for small-scale projects but may lack long-term reliability. Rates range from $30 to $150 per hour.
- Development Agencies: Offer end-to-end solutions with dedicated teams. Rates range from $50 to $250 per hour.
- In-House Development Teams: Provide long-term support but require a higher initial investment in salaries and infrastructure.
